How is STEP compliance being administered at the marine terminals?
The Port provides the marine terminals with an electronic list of STEP compliant trucks at 10.00pm each night. This list is also updated during the day as new STEP compliant trucks are added to the Port Registry. Each marine terminal uses an RFID reader at the gate to recognize the RFID tag attached to each truck. The truck will be allowed to enter the marine terminal if the truck information associated with the RFID tag matches the information on the electronic list of STEP compliant trucks provided by the Port. STEP non-compliant trucks will be directed to the Port CSC for assistance.
